Go to your data\fs2open_pxo.cfg file and open it in notepad. It should say

66.25.7.157
12000

If it doesn't you have an old one. If you don't have one at all make a new file with that name (be careful it isn't saved as fs2open_pxo.cfg.txt) and try again. 

If FS2NetD is failing to log on you'd only see the games on your own LAN which is almost certainly none.

Actually it seems to be down again. I could get to the registration page fine. However, when I pinged 66.25.7.157 in command prompt it gave me four "request timed out" straight away.  :rolleyes:

Ping is a bad tool for checking if internet servers are up or not as many servers are set to simply eat them without returning anything as a security measure.
